As others have said would be nice to see the faces, however I like the fact you've captured the stumps flying and the players stand out well :)

If you cropped this as well the noise will look more than it is, you could use the magnetic selection tool, select the two players, invert the selection and then run some noise reduction on the rest as that doesn't matter if it gets a bit softer and noise seems to be worse in the bokeh
